Check out these photos from Simon Fraser University's Holi bash on the weekend, celebrating the Indian festival of colours.
People fill the streets of India with a splash of vibrant colours, play dhol , dance to every beat and have a joyous time to celebrate the arrival of spring.
And on or the first time since 2018, Burnaby's own Simon Fraser University celebrated Holi with a festival held Sunday at its Burnaby Mountain campus.
